titleOfInvention | Electrolytic solution for electrolytic capacitor and electrolytic capacitor |
abstract | Disclosed are an electrolytic solution for driving an electrolytic capacitor capable of suppressing gas generation caused by reaction with electrolytic paper and preventing appearance abnormality such as expansion of an explosion-proof valve, and an electrolytic capacitor. As an electrolytic solution for driving an electrolytic capacitor, an enzyme such as xylanase, lignin peroxidase, or cellulase is used for an electrolytic solution containing ethylene glycol or the like as a main solvent and carboxylic acid and / or its ammonium salt as a main solute. 0.1-10.0 wt% is mix | blended with respect to the whole electrolyte solution. Thereby, the chemical reaction between the electrolytic solution and the electrolytic paper can be suppressed, and the expansion of the explosion-proof valve can be suppressed.
